What is the Bucket of Sand Workout?

The bucket of sand workout involves using a bucket filled with sand as a weightlifting tool. The bucket can range in size from a small bucket to a large drum, depending on your fitness level and the exercises you choose to perform. The sand provides a variable resistance, making the workout challenging and adaptable to your progress.

Techniques for the Bucket of Sand Workout

Here are some essential techniques to help you perform the bucket of sand workout effectively:

  • Proper form: Always maintain good posture and form to prevent injury. Keep your back straight, shoulders relaxed, and core engaged.

  • Start with a light weight: Begin with a bucket filled with a small amount of sand to get accustomed to the movement and build your strength gradually.

  • Gradually increase the weight: As you become more comfortable with the exercises, increase the amount of sand in the bucket to challenge yourself further.

  • Focus on controlled movements: Avoid using momentum to lift the bucket; instead, focus on controlled and deliberate movements.

  • Breathe properly: Inhale before lifting and exhale during the exertion phase of the exercise.

Exercises to Try

Here are some popular exercises you can incorporate into your bucket of sand workout:

  • Deadlifts: Stand with the bucket between your feet, bend at the hips and knees, and lift the bucket by extending your hips and knees.

  • Squats: Hold the bucket in front of you and perform a squat by bending your knees and hips, then returning to the starting position.

  • Shoulder press: Hold the bucket overhead and press it up by extending your arms, then lower it back down.

  • Push-ups: Place the bucket on the ground and perform push-ups by pushing yourself up and down, keeping your body in a straight line.

  • Planks: Hold the bucket in front of you and perform a plank by keeping your body in a straight line, holding the position for as long as possible.

Table: Bucket of Sand Workout Exercises and Sets/Reps

Exercise Sets Reps
Deadlifts 3 10-15
Squats 3 12-15
Shoulder press 3 10-15
Push-ups 3 10-15
Planks 3 30-60 seconds
